About this service

Safety sensors are the small devices located near the floor that prevent the door from closing on objects. If your door reverses immediately or the lights on the opener flash, your sensors might be misaligned or faulty. You need a technician to troubleshoot the wiring or adjust the alignment to restore safe operation. The cost typically depends on whether the sensors just need adjustment or a full replacement.
